FACULTY OF MEDICAL SCIENCE 199 Synopsis of Classes Py-M 2-3 Tu and Th 11-12 -M 3-6 throughout the Session and 10-1 Michaelmas Term only Sj -M 2-3 Tu and Th 11-12 -Tu 2-3 Lent and Easter Terms only S3 -F 10-1 BOTANY AND PLANT BIOLOGY Head of the Department Professor Gates Ph LL This Course comprises Lectures and Practical Work in Botany required for the First Examination of the University of London -Elementary Botany Lectures Tu 2-3 2-3 The Lectures treat of the general principles of Plant Morphology Histology Physiology Cytology Heredity and Evolution and will be illustrated by fresh and dried specimens of plants museum material microsoopio preparations and large collection of diagrams drawings and lantern slides -Practical Work -Tu 3-6 throughout the Session In the Practical Class the Students will examine the structure of the tissues and organs of the various types prescribed for the First Examination the work being arranged in connection with the Lectures Ps -Revision Course Lecture 10-11 Practical 2-5 during the Michaelmas Term This is special course for Students desiring to pass the First Examination in December ZOOLOGY AND ANIMAL BIOLOGY Head of the Department Professor Doris Livingston Mackinnon Sc For Students taking the first Medical Examination of the University of London Pj -Elementary Zoology Lectures Tu 12-1 12-1 General Structure Physiology and Life History of Amoeba Hcema- tococcus Paramecium Monocystis Malarial Parasite Obelia Tvenia Lumbricus Scyllium Rana and Lepus The Cell and Cell- division-The Elements of Vertebrate Histology-The Elements of Vertebrate Embryology with special reference to Amphioxue Qallus and Lepus Biological Theory -Organic Evolution-Variation-Heredity- Natural Selection &c
